Operations Lead

Calgary, AB
 
Job Purpose: The Operations Lead will assist with the daily operations which include sales, preparing quotations, responding to customer requests and facilitating dispatch, permits, safety, and compliance. The Operations Lead will act as the branch’s liaison between the customer and operations to ensure customer needs are met through preparation of quotations through to execution and completion.

Responsibilities:
  • Coordinate personnel and equipment for designated projects.
  • Coordinate Permits and Line Lifts for Alberta, BC and Sask.
  • Coordinate driver movements, direct drivers, distribute routing, schedule drivers to handle loads, monitor required documentation, cross-reference tickets and driver time cards, ensure billing practices are followed and meet customer service requirements.
  • Work closely with maintenance crew to schedule and meet service requirements.
  • Update driver schedules in a timely manner.
  • Maintain PO’s, service requests, permits etc.
  • Ensure that all personnel maintain a “safety comes first” philosophy and supporting a strong safety culture within NCSG.
  • Answer and direct calls during regular business hours, as well as after hours on a 2-week cycle on-call rotation.
  • Ensure that all jobs are conducted within company and government policies and regulations.
  • Write standard pricing proposals and quotations to customer requests with input from field crews for better understanding of job scope if necessary
  • Ensure that all personnel have the required safety courses and certifications.
  • Assist with safety orientations and coordinate training for all new and existing personnel.
  • Liaise with the HS&E and Training division to continually enhance the transportation safety and compliance systems.
  • Maintain the document management processes necessary for ensuring record keeping compliance.
  • Assist with administration as required.
  • Complete special projects as assigned.

Requirements:
  • Familiarity with oilfield hauling equipment along with a proven track record of client relations.
  • Understanding of dispatch functions an asset.
  • Willingness to take after hours on-call on a 2-week cycle, alternating between dispatchers.
  • Additional certification or training relating to position an asset.
  • Highly organized and able to handle a full workload while having strong attention to detail.
  • Cooperative and professional ability to assist others.
  • Good communication and coordination with supervisory, field and area personnel.
  • Understanding of accurate paperwork importance.
  • Basic computer knowledge, proficient with Microsoft Word/Office and Excel.
  • Self starter with the ability to solve complex problems using sound professional judgment, creativity, and innovation.
  • Must have reliable transportation.
